Scythe is an engine-building, asymmetric, competitive board game set in an alternate-history 1920s period. It is a time of farming and war, broken hearts and rusted gears, innovation and valor.
It is a time of unrest in 1920s Europa. The ashes from the first great war still darken the snow. The capitalistic city-state known simply as âThe Factory,â which fueled the war with heavily armored mechs, has closed its doors, drawing the attention of several nearby countries.
In Scythe, each player represents a fallen leader attempting to restore their honor and lead their faction to power in Eastern Europa. Players conquer territory, enlist new recruits, reap resources, gain villagers, build structures, and activate monstrous mechs.
Rising Sun is a board game for 3 to 5 players set in legendary feudal Japan. As the Kami descend from the heavens to reshape the land in their image, it is up to each player to lead their clan to victory. Use politics to further your cause, negotiate to seek the most profitable alliances, worship the Kami to gain their favor, recruit monsters out of legend to bolster your forces, and use your resources wisely to be victorious in battle.
It is 1898. London has returned to peace for eight years following Count Draculaâs thwarted plans, or so they thoughtâŠ
In Fury of Dracula, one player is Count Dracula secretly traveling the European countries, turning humans into vampires with his gruesome bite, and laying deadly traps for those hunting him. The Countâs opponents are the Hunters who must find the bloodthirsty villain and destroy him before his undead thralls claim the night as their own.
Arkham is home to a host of strange, otherworldly occurrences, from bizarre astronomical events to a sense of déjà vu that permeates the whole city.
Few know the terrible truth, the source of these anomalies, the nightmares beyond imagination. But it is an investigator's job to get to the putrid heart of these mysteries, to follow horrifying threads and discover this unknowable truth. Can they survive with their sanity intact?
There are four distinct scenarios inviting you to journey into Arkham, and these scenarios provide a new way to play the game with every playthrough. Not only do they provide different goals, monsters, board layouts, and narrative stories, these narratives even have branching paths based on your performance and choices. Regardless of the scenario, your investigators will be pushed to the edge of sanity in their search for answers better left unearthed.
Natureâs creativity and diversity is on display in Speciationâs ever-changing lineup of beers, ciders, and wines. Speciation Artisan Ales takes an evolutionary approach to brewing wild fermented beer, open fermenting everything to capture native microbes to give each batch a unique flavor profile.
